Responsibilities:
- Collaborate with business leaders, engineers, and product managers to understand data needs.
- Interface with other technology teams to extract, transform, and load data from a wide variety of data sources using cloud-native data engineering principles
- Design, build, and scale data pipelines across a variety of source systems and streams (internal, third-party, cloud-based), distributed/elastic environments, and downstream applications.
- Identify, design, and implement internal process improvements: automating manual processes, optimizing data delivery, re-designing infrastructure for greater scalability, etc.
- Implement the appropriate design patterns while optimizing performance, cost, security, and scale and end user experience.
- Participate and lead in development sprints, demos, and retrospectives, as well as release and deployment.
- Build and manage relationships with supporting IT teams in order to effectively deliver work products to production.
Basic Requirements:
- 5+ years of experience in a data engineering or related role
- Direct experience designing and building data modeling, ETL/ELT development principles, or data warehousing concepts
- Strong knowledge of data management fundamentals and data storage principles
- Deep experience in building data pipelines using Python/SQL
- Deep experience in Airflow or similar orchestration engines
- Deep experience in applying CI/CD principles and processes to data engineering solutions.
- Strong understanding of cloud data engineering design patterns and use cases
- Experience with Google Cloud Platform (GCP), such as Big Query, Composer, VertexAI, GCS, and other GCP resources
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Data Science, Statistics, Informatics, Information Systems, Mathematics, Computer Engineering, or quantitative field.
Desired Characteristics:
- Knowledge of Medallion Architecture
- Experience using DBT
- Experience using Apache Iceberg to manage datasets
